Output 2a58bc91c1c6ad2be6964dc6204792da8d02ee9a527b0ccb16d5ab06c1ddaef5:1

value
18112724
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0238177ef9904a46af7912fdcaed85c135131c9 OP_EQUAL
address
3LfZ1RgHzMJnfiSjtz5Zwkp8MLV52EkwS1
transaction
2a58bc91c1c6ad2be6964dc6204792da8d02ee9a527b0ccb16d5ab06c1ddaef5
confirmations
268568
spent
true